Clouds on the Horizon
Therefore do not worry about tomorrow, for tomorrow will worry about itself. Each day has enough trouble of its own.
— Matt. 6:34
— Matt. 6:34
Standing on the beach, looking inland. It's sunny here, but in the distance, we see dark clouds and lightning. Do we run to the car or stay? Today, we stay, and the storm never arrives. In life, many storms could strike. I can easily imagine they will. Lots never do, and all the worry is wasted.
